Frequently asked questions
What does Parapet's platform actually do for fund managers?
Parapet automates the legal and operational steps required to form a private investment fund — entity structuring, subscription document execution, investor accreditation verification, KYC/AML checks, and ongoing compliance tracking. The platform generates limited partnership agreements from templates, processes capital calls and distributions, and maintains audit trails for regulatory filings. This replaces manual workflows that traditionally required coordination between external law firms, fund administrators, and in-house operations teams.
Is Parapet a registered investment advisor or just a software vendor?
Parapet is an SEC-registered entity, which distinguishes it from generic software providers serving the financial industry. Its own regulatory status means the compliance infrastructure it sells is built by a firm operating under the same oversight framework as its asset manager clients. This structure embeds regulatory accountability into the product itself, rather than outsourcing compliance design to software engineers without fiduciary obligations.
